The Evolution of Steroid Legality in Russia

To comprehend the current market, one should take a look at the legal framework. Historically, Russia was substantially more lenient relating to performance-enhancing drugs (PEDs) compared to Western nations. Nevertheless, under global pressure and a desire to modernize its sporting image, the Russian government tightened its grip.

Article 234 of the Criminal Code

The most considerable legal hurdle for anybody seeking to buy steroids in Russia is Article 234 of the Criminal Code of the Russian Federation. This law governs the "Illegal Traffic of Potent or Poisonous Substances for the Purpose of Sale."

Under this post:

  1. Possession for Sale: If a person is captured with a "large scale" quantity of steroids (specified by weight, often as low as one or 2 vials/boxes), they might face considerable prison time, varying from three to 8 years.
  2. Personal Use: While the law primarily targets sellers, the definition of "intent to offer" can be subjective. Simple belongings of large quantities is frequently interpreted as intent to distribute.
  3. Imports: Ordering steroids from abroad into Russia is highly dangerous and regularly results in "Smuggling" charges, which bring even harsher penalties.

The "Underground" Reality

A considerable portion of steroids offered in Russia are made in domestic "basement" labs. These laboratories purchase raw hormonal agent powders from China and blend them with carrier oils (like grapeseed or sesame oil) and solvents. While some UGLs keep high requirements, others may produce items that are under-dosed or contaminated with germs.

3. Health Consequences

The useful nature of this guide need to highlight that AAS use without medical guidance threatens. Potential side effects consist of:

  • Cardiovascular stress and high blood pressure.
  • Liver toxicity (particularly with oral steroids).
  • Suppression of natural testosterone production.
  • Psychological results, including mood swings and aggression.
